About N-[[6-[(6-methoxy-2-pyridinyl)amino]-2-pyridinyl]sulfonyl]-2-(2,2,3-trimethylpyrrolidin-1-yl)pyridine-3-carboxamide

N-[[6-[(6-methoxy-2-pyridinyl)amino]-2-pyridinyl]sulfonyl]-2-(2,2,3-trimethylpyrrolidin-1-yl)pyridine-3-carboxamide (PubChem CID 175515392) has the molecular formula C24H28N6O4S and a molecular weight of 496.59 g/mol. Its IUPAC name is N-[[6-[(6-methoxy-2-pyridinyl)amino]-2-pyridinyl]sulfonyl]-2-(2,2,3-trimethylpyrrolidin-1-yl)pyridine-3-carboxamide.
